Record Group II, Series 25
Manuel Lozano.
    Secretarial files, 1920-1943.
     .8 linear ft. (2 boxes).

    Arranged alphabetically by subject.
    Manuel Lozano was the personal and business secretary of Manuel Rionda y Polledo during the last twenty-three years of Rionda's life.  Lozano died several months before Rionda passed away in September, 1943.
     These files contain edited drafts and copies of letters, cables, statements, reports, and other documents presumably found in Series 2 and Series 10.  Also included in this series are memoranda of correspondence received by Rionda from 1928-1938.  These are not complete and have been retained here more as an indication of how the president's office was run than as documentation of company activity.  Similarly, memoranda related to office policy and staff operations have also been retained.
